The Andrew Carter Podcast is a daily, high-paced, round-up of stories and news impacting Montrealers. While the podcast delivers the latest political, health and entertainment headlines - it will also leave you with a smile.

Prime Minister Mark Carney says Canada is NOT looking to join the EU. Instead, he wants a “unique alliance” with Europe, at a time when our trade relationship with the United States is becoming increasingly uncertain. What would EU membership actually mean for Canada. Moshe Lander, senior lecturer in economics at Concordia University, spoke to Andrew Carter. Photo Credit: THE CANADIAN PRESS/Justin Tang

Céline Dion is back on stage in Paris, and for those of us here in Quebec, it’s an incredibly emotional moment. After years away from performing, Céline opened her Paris residency Saturday night in front of 30,000 people. Quebec guitarist Jeff Smallwood, who is performing with her throughout this run, spoke to Andrew Carter. Photo Credit: (AP Photo/Aurelien Morissard)

We’ve heard plenty of warnings about artificial intelligence taking jobs, spreading misinformation and becoming difficult to control — but now some AI researchers are warning about something much more extreme: that AI could potentially threaten the survival of humanity. A senior researcher at Anthropic recently put the odds of AI causing human extinction within the next decade at more than ten per cent. Simon Blanchette is a McGill lecturer who specializes in AI and the future of work, and he spoke to Andrew Carter.
